Green Goddess Chopped Salad with Crunchy Veggies
A vibrant mix of crisp greens, crunchy veggies, and a creamy Green Goddess dressing that'll have you reaching for seconds.

Ingredients
Servings:
- 4 cups mixed greens
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
- 1/2 cup cucumber, diced
- 1/2 red bell pepper, diced
- 1/4 red onion, finely chopped
- 1/2 cup cooked chickpeas
- 1/4 cup crumbled feta cheese
- 1/4 cup sunflower seeds
- 1 avocado, sliced
- 1/2 cup mayonnaise
- 2 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ped
- 2 tbsp fresh chives, chopped
- 1 tbsp fresh tarragon, chopped
- 1 clove garlic, minced
- 1 tbsp lemon juice
- Salt and pepper to taste
Steps
- 1 In a large bowl, combine mixed greens, cherry tomatoes, cucumber, red bell pepper, red onion, and chickpeas.
- 2 In a separate small bowl, mix mayonnaise, parsley, chives, tarragon, garlic, and lemon juice. Season with salt and pepper.
- 3 Pour the Green Goddess dressing over the salad and toss to coat.
- 4 Top with crumbled feta, sunflower seeds, and avocado slices just before serving.

Variations
- Add grilled shrimp for a seafood twist.
- Substitute sunflower seeds with toasted almonds for extra crunch.
Substitutions
- Use Greek yogurt in place of mayonnaise for a lighter dressing.
- Substitute feta cheese with goat cheese for a tangier flavor.

Tips
- For a vegan option, substitute feta with additional sunflower seeds or chopped olives.
- Prepare the salad base and dressing separately to keep veggies crisp if making ahead.
Storage
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. Toss with additional dressing before serving.
Freezing: This salad does not freeze well due to the fresh vegetables and dressing.
